Solicitor vs paralegal

The differences between solicitors and paralegals can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a solicitor has an average salary of $75,278, which is higher than the $49,943 average annual salary of a paralegal.

The top three skills for a solicitor include litigation, foreclosure and alumni. The most important skills for a paralegal are litigation, legal research, and law firm.
